Job description

The Procurement Manager is responsible for leading all sourcing and purchasing activities within the Pensacola manufacturing facility. This role ensures material availability, cost control, supplier quality, and compliance through disciplined execution of the ASD Lean Operating System. Reporting to the Materials & Planning Manager, this position drives supplier performance, team development, and cost improvement initiatives that support production continuity, inventory targets, and SQDCCP performance. The Procurement Manager partners closely with Operations, Quality, and Maintenance to deliver reliable supply, safe supplier engagement, and continuous improvement in all procurement processes.

Position Impact

The Procurement Manager plays a critical role in ensuring material flow reliability, supplier performance, and cost efficiency. Success in this position is measured by the ability to meet SQDCCP targets, deliver year-over-year cost improvement, and strengthen the procurement system as an integrated part of the ASD Lean Operating System.

1. Procurement Leadership & Supplier Management
  • Lead daily procurement operations ensuring 100% material availability and supplier on-time delivery.
  • Manage and develop a team of four buyers, providing coaching and accountability through daily Tier 1-2 meetings and Leader Standard Work (LSW).
  • Establish and manage supplier relationships to support OHD's long-term cost, quality, and delivery objectives.
  • Negotiate contracts, pricing, and delivery schedules to achieve productivity and cost-reduction goals.
  • Maintain dual-source strategies for critical commodities to reduce risk and ensure supply continuity.
2. System Discipline & Materials Alignment
  • Integrate procurement activities with SIOP, production planning, and scheduling to ensure end-to-end supply chain synchronization.
  • Ensure accurate and timely data entry across ERP/MRP systems (MXP, JD Edwards, Oracle) supporting enterprise data integrity.
  • Drive compliance to ASD procurement policies, approval workflows, and vendor qualification processes.
  • Collaborate with Materials & Planning and Operations to meet inventory turns, PPV, and service level targets.
3. Safety, Quality & Compliance
  • Model ASD's 'Safety First' culture by ensuring vendor and employee adherence to all plant safety procedures.
  • Partner with EHS and Maintenance to verify supplier safety compliance, certifications, and material handling standards.
  • Uphold the Quality Control Plan and participate in supplier quality reviews and corrective action processes.
  • Ensure alignment between procurement specifications, quality standards, and regulatory requirements.
4. Continuous Improvement & Cost Optimization
  • Lead cost-reduction projects through Lean sourcing, supplier consolidation, and process improvement.Utilize PDCA and root cause analysis for supply disruptions, pricing escalations, and delivery failures.
  • Support standardization and simplification of procurement processes aligned to ASD Lean Operating System principles.
  • Track and report KPI performance; drive countermeasures through tiered management routines.
5. Team Development & Leadership
  • Develop buyer and sourcing specialist capability through structured coaching and cross-training.
  • Conduct performance reviews and create individual development plans aligned with ASD leadership expectations.
  • Reinforce accountability through LSW, daily huddles, and problem-solving coaching.
  • Foster collaboration, empowerment, and ownership within the procurement team.
